❶�Field construction channel - Place concrete after provid-ing a hole that can accommodate the dimension A. After removing the form, install a valve, fix it with mortar or calking compound and then install a specified pipe.
❷�When using a concrete pit - Place concrete after setting a circular blank form. Follow then the steps same as above.
❸�Flume channel without hole - Bore hole at a required posi-tion. Follow then the steps same as above.
■ Measuring methodMeasuring device is set horizontally on a channel with variable slope. Attaching a valve to the leading end of the device, water is drained to a triangular weir tank.Amount of flow is obtained by measuring the water received in a bucket, when the amount is small (approx. 1 litter/sec), or by measuring the depth of water in the triangular weir in the other.
❹�When installing on earth channel - Jacket the valve with a small amount of concrete, and then install a pipe.
❺�When taking bottom water from flume - Install by providing a concrete pit at the flume joint, and then install the valve.
❻�When heights of water intake position and outlet are different largely - Provide a pit on the irrigation channel, use a bent pipe or finely adjust the angle to install the valve and provide a diversion pit at the outlet.

■Construction method for preventing clogged conduitDraining effect of conduits decreases with progress of time owing to clogging.Jet cleansing, or the like, is employed at some places to prevent clogged conduits. These methods, how-ever, are not only expensive but also complicated in handling, maintenance or control. They are not promul-gated so much also because, for example, they may not be applicable depending on conditions of piping.Cleansing method utilizing valves (Model A) has been introduced to solve such problems. 3-way watertight structure (Fig. 1)◦��When closed fully, water is stopped at watertight sections at three sides of
shutter (bottom, left and right). Water overflows beyond the shutter.◦��Application example
It is installed at the downstream side of intake from channel to dam up water.
* Concrete anchors are not included. Procure at site referring to the dimension R.
4-way watertight structure (Fig. 2)◦��Since, when closed fully, water is stopped at the watertight sections at
four sides of shutter (top, bottom, left and right), water level may be raised beyond the height of shutter. (Round type model has a 4-way watertight structure because it is watertight over entire circumference.)
◦��Application example It is installed at the entrance of conduit for diversion pit to divert water.
■ Anchor bolt construction (Standard)To install on a concrete wall, drill a little larger holes aligning to the positions of a pair of flash bolts (M6 or M10) provided on the left and right frames of main unit.Pack the drilled holes with mortar, and fix the product by means of strut, etc.After fixing the position of product, fill up the clearance between the concrete wall and the product with motor or calking compound. (Fig. 3)
■ Concrete anchor constructionWhen installing the product with concrete anchors, after drilling anchor holes, make sure to fill rubber type joint filler in the clearance between the product and concrete wall before tightening nuts (Fig. 4).
■ Block-out constructionSet the product in the block-out position and pack mortar or sealing agent.

❶�Standard sizes for drainage pipe per unit block area are considered to be 100 for 1,000 square meters, 125 per 2,000 square meters and 150 per 3,000 square meters, though it could vary depending on the amount of rainfall, draining time, depth of impound water, or other, at particular area. It is considered also to install the product at two or more places in unit block area.
❷�Since the L shape external cylinder is installed at approx. 100°and an O ring is attached to the joint to drain pipe, it can be installed arbitrarily under ordinary conditions. Where it is installed at a very steep slope, use the drain pipe after cutting obliquely. (Model E)
❸�Install the drainage pipe with its top end at approx. 30 mm below the average height of the surface of paddy field.
❹�When burying the drainage pipe, tread down the ground sufficiently after it is buried.
❺�Since this drainage pipe is buried at the end toe of slope in principle, use a semi circular concrete pipe, short U shape flume, building block, sand bag, etc., as logging for the slope.
❻�When installing the internal cylinder, set it with the triangle mark indicated on the flange oriented to the surface of paddy field. Lock further the internal cylinder with the at-tached O ring. (Model E)
❼�Since the drain hole for winter time is utilized as a draining hole after draining rice farming water or during secondary crop farming, it is opened if it is inserted with the triangle mark oriented to the drainage channel. Cut open the front of the opening to secure a complete draining. (Model E)

WEEP HOLE is used to reduce uplift pressure in rivers, reservoirs and water channels.Generally, removal of seepage water or subsurface water around concrete channel would be required, otherwise channel would be floated by the water uplift pressure causing cracks to the structure.WEEP HOLE effectively discharges seepage water or subsurface water without underground soil into the channel, on the other hand, when the channel water level rises, rubber valve of WEEP HOLE closes by cause of water pres-sure preventing channel water from seeping in underground.There are various types of WEEP HOLE (G, GD, GI, GS, GP, GH and GT) depending on the condition being ap-plied at the side wall or bottom of the water channel.

If subsurface water level is high, concrete water channels and reservoirs may be floated by the water uplift pressure of the subsurface water, causing cracks or float to the concrete portion. This is where the underdrain construction method or the sidedrain construction method is employed, and WEEP HOLE is used to prevent backflow at the drain outlet. Seepage control sheets (soft PVC, rubber) are frequently used for river banks, storage reservoirs and balancing res-ervoirs. However, a problem is how to eliminate uplift pressure due to subsurface water, spring water or remaining air. To solve this problem, we have newly developed WEEP HOLE for Sheet.WEEP HOLE for Sheet is composed of a stainless steel cover, a presser ring, a rubber valve and a screw type main body (synthetic resin). Since the structure is so simple, WEEP HOLE for Sheet is robust free from trouble. Also, WEEP HOLE for Sheet is so small and light, it can be mounted directly on sheets. When WEEP HOLE for Sheet is used together with a drain pipe or an air vent valve, safety can be furthered. For the amount of “weight” for prevent-ing the float of sheets, refer to the calculation formula described later. Thus, WEEP HOLE for Sheet ensures the safety of bank bodies, and substantially reduces the construction labor and cost.

Recently, the sheet pile construction method has been increasingly utilized for water channel revetment, etc. in the soft ground area. However, WEEP HOLEs and drain pipes used for this method have not yet been popularly used, and the back pressure is left unmitigated. When water treatment is provided to this backland, the back pressure can be mitigated, and the ground can be stabilized. In order to prevent disaster due to the moistening phenomena at the backland, we have developed WEEP HOLE for Sheet Piling.

Since the outside hydraulic pressure working on tunnels has a critical impact over the stability of their structures, it should be alleviated upon occurrence. For this purpose, WEEP HOLE for Tunnel (without valve) is mounted in the tunnel arch portion. For mounting WEEP HOLE under the design water surface in tunnels, WEEP HOLE for Tunnel (with valve) is used.
◦�Weep Hole for Tunnel (without valve) is integrally consists of a water permeable pipe filter having an inside diameter of 26 mm and an outside diameter of 32 mm and a PVC pipe VP25 (Q = lining length).
◦�Weep Hole for Tunnels is inserted into a wall hole pre-bored to approx. 50 mm, made water-tight with an O-ring, and filled with a sealing agent at the surface area for finishing. *Specify the lining length in your order sheet.
